A pair of George II silver waiters
maker's mark of John Tuite, London, 1734
Shaped-circular and three hoof feet, with moulded rim, the centres engraved with a crest, marked on reverse
6¼in. (5.7cm.) diam.
16ozs. (514grs.) (2)
